One game check for Trent Williams is $1.11 million. The 49ers have the ability to fine him up to that amount for every missed preseason game, but that's up to their discretion. The missed practices are mandatory, non-forgivable fines
@MaioccoNBCS: Trent Williams was a holdout for the first 13 practices of 49ers training camp. At $50,000 a day in fines, that's $650,000. According to the CBA, he is also subject to a fine of one regular-season game check for each preseason game missed.

The San Francisco 49ers opened their preseason schedule Saturday against the Tennessee Titans.
While most of the 49ers’ starters sat out, a handful of players who are expected to earn starting jobs in Week 1 took the field for the first exhibition match of the year.
Left guard Aaron Banks was among the starters. So was right tackle Colton McKivitz. Rookie third-round pick Dominick Puni also looks to be on track for a starting role in 2024.
He got the start in the preseason opener after taking hold of the right guard job in camp when Spencer Burford and Jon Feliciano both went down with injuries

The Tennessee Titans seemingly went all-in on second-year quarterback Will Levis this offseason. The Titans fired former head coach Mike Vrabel and replaced him with former Bengals offensive coordinator Brian Callahan.
Callahan, a former UCLA quarterback, is known for his work with quarterbacks. He spent the last four seasons coaching Joe Burrow in Cincinnati.
Additionally, Tennessee spent big money at wide receiver, landing Calvin Ridley and Tyler Boyd to a group that already had DeAndre Hopkins and former first-round pick Treylon Burks. The Titans also signed free-agent running back Tony Pollard to a three-year deal, signed center Lloyd Cushenberry (four years) and used a top-10 pick on Alabama offensive tackle JC Latham

The 2024 Tennessee Titans are one of the NFL’s most mysterious teams. Tennessee underwent more change this offseason than anyone in the NFL outside of the Washington Commanders.
The Titans fired a successful head coach to bring in a first-time head coach. Mike Vrabel’s time in Tennessee seemed to be nearing its end for a while. Not only had the Titans had back-to-back losing seasons, but there were some issues between Vrabel and ownership.
Enter Brian Callahan. Callahan comes to Tennessee with a reputation for developing quarterbacks, which makes him the perfect mentor for Will Levis. The Titans completely revamped the offensive side of the ball this offseason, bringing in players such as Calvin Ridley, Tony Pollard, Tyler Boyd, Lloyd Cushenberry, and JC Latham

The Tennessee Titans hosted the San Francisco 49ers in their first preseason game of 2024. In a 17-13 victory over the Niners, the Titans had one standout player who made the biggest impact in their first game. Chance Campbell is the first Player of the Game for 2024.
The Titans linebacker made his presence known all over the field tonight. He recorded nine tackles (five solo), one sack, one tackle for a loss, a quarterback hit, and one pass defensed, and he ended the game by intercepting the ball with one second left on the clock
